Introduction

PopMedNet version 6.7.1 is patch release to the PopMedNet distributed query tool that includes several bug fixes. 

Bug Fixes

UpdateDescription

The ‘Response Approval’ step was skipped when select DataMarts uploaded results

Requests were skipping the ‘Response Approval’ step for select DataMarts. This bug caused results to be sent directly to the Coordinating Center following upload to the DataMart Client rather than wait for approval despite proper security settings and permissions.

This bug has been fixed for all DataMarts that require results to be reviewed and approved.  Any uploaded results will go to the ‘Awaiting Response Approval’ status and will require a reviewer to approve the results before the routing is marked ‘Complete’ and is available for download by the Coordinating Center.

Non-zipped files sent from the query tool appeared to be corrupted when downloaded from the DataMart Client.


This has been corrected.  Error messages will no longer appear when opening a non-zip file downloaded from the DataMart Client. 

An error message appears when unzipping a request file downloaded from the DataMart Client (DMC) that indicates the zip file is empty. The zip files were are actually empty, but cannot be unzipped using windows extraction

This has been fixed. Windows extraction can now be used to unzip files downloaded from the DMC.

Response ZIP files downloaded from the query tool are empty.

Some large response files were not uploaded to the DMC even when they appeared to upload successfully. Therefore, these zip files were empty when downloaded from the query tool. This has been fixed and the file size limit for a file uploaded via the DMC is 2GB.

Known Issues

IssueWorkaround
Response Detail Web Portal tab resizing

In Firefox, Internet Explorer, and Edge, the Response Detail tab for Question Engine-based requests may occasionally not resize properly to accommodate viewing a large number of DataMart responses at once. This will prevent the user from being able to view results directly on the PMN Web Portal, but it does not prevent the user from downloading results. Two workarounds have been identified:

  • Use Chrome or Safari web browsers when viewing results on the PMN Web Portal. These browsers are not affected by this issue.
  • In Firefox, when the Response Detail window fails to resize, right-click the contents of the Response Detail tab and click This Frame>Reload Frame.
Checking for NULL ADMIT_DATEs in PCORnet Menu-Driven QueriesThe Observation Period term in PCORnet Menu-Driven Queries fails to check that ADMIT_DATEs are not NULL if both minimum and maximum dates are left blank when creating the query. To avoid this, always enter a minimum and/or maximum date when using the Observation Period term in PCORnet Menu-Driven Queries. This is expected to be fixed in PopMedNet 6.7.
The "Contact Us" link on the SSO log in page for the Sentinel Query Tool opens an email to support@popmednet.orgIf you have any questions or need assitance with the Sentinel Query Tool or DataMart client, please navigate directly to the PopMedNet Service Desk
Error when double-clicking on a request file in the DataMart ClientWhen a DataMart Administrator opens a new file distribution or modular program request, they must click on that file in order to download it.  In many instances, if the user double-clicks on that file, an error appears and the DataMart Client closes.  to avoid this, all users should single-click on any files for download in the DataMart Client.
